site stats

Binary sort algorithm c++

WebJun 28, 2024 · Binary Search is a method to find the required element in a sorted array by repeatedly halving the array and searching in the half. This method is done by starting with the whole array. Then it is halved. If the required data value is greater than the element at the middle of the array, then the upper half of the array is considered. WebIn this tutorial, you will learn about the quick sort algorithm and its implementation in Python, Java, C, and C++. Quicksort is a sorting algorithm based on the divide and conquer approach where. An array is divided into subarrays by selecting a pivot element (element selected from the array). While dividing the array, the pivot element should ...

Bubble Sort (With Code in Python/C++/Java/C)

WebApr 7, 2024 · Sorted by: 2. The only thing that seems to be wrong is the insertIntoArray (). The first issue is that you are passing an unitialized variable as a parameter: int index; insertIntoArray (arr, maintree, index); … WebJul 27, 2024 · It can be used to sort arrays. This searching technique follows the divide and conquer strategy. The search space always reduces to half in every iteration. Binary Search Algorithm is a very efficient technique for searching but it needs some order on which partition of the array will occur. rawang forest https://asouma.com

Binary Search (With Code) - Programiz

WebNov 16, 2024 · Unit 7: Searching and Sorting Algorithms; 7.6: Binary Search, Bubble Sort, and Selection Sorts; Binary Search, Bubble Sort, and Selection Sort in C++ ... Bubble Sort, and Selection Sorts\' Binary Search, Bubble Sort, and Selection Sort in C++. Mark as completed Since the lectures in this unit use Python for illustration, review these … WebIn this article, we will learn binary search algorithm. Binary search algorithm is used to search an element in a given set of elements. It works on a sorted list of data. It starts … WebMar 31, 2014 · A binary sort is a very fast algorithm which involves bit testing. It has a single pass for each bit in the sortable item. For each pass, if the bit is set then the sortable item is stacked at one end of the buffer. If the bit is not set then the item is stacked at the other end of the buffer. Starting the sort at the least significant bit and ... rawang integrated industrial park company

Answered: Theory of Algorithm Analysis:… bartleby

Category:c++ - How to read a binary file into a vector of unsigned integer ...

Tags:Binary sort algorithm c++

Binary sort algorithm c++

algorithm - Implementing a binary insertion sort using binary search …

Webc++ c++,显示给定特定条件的多集中现有对象的列表 标签: C++ 基本上,我有一个代表花的类,它有一些字段-名称,是开花(字符串),家庭和高度 我需要实现一个函数,搜索符合条件的所有元素,这是一个特定的姓氏。 WebThe program. C++ CLI program (No GUI): Write a program that reads a text file and stores each word in an array. Write one of the iterative sorting algorithms to sort the data. Once the data is sorted, write a binary sort algorithm that, when given a string, returns either the index of the string or a -1 to indicate the string was not found in ...

Binary sort algorithm c++

Did you know?

WebJan 17, 2024 · Binary Search Approach: Binary Search is a searching algorithm used in a sorted array by repeatedly dividing the search interval in half. The idea of binary search … WebJul 18, 2024 · Merge step using binary search in merge sort algorithm. We have to convert serial code into parallel code, according to my research it is not possible to paralllelize …

WebJan 29, 2024 · Remarks. The C++ Standard Library algorithms can operate on various data structures. The data structures that they can operate on include not only the C++ Standard Library container classes such as vector and list, but also user-defined data structures and arrays of elements, as long as they satisfy the requirements of a particular … WebSorting is a very classic problem of reordering items (that can be compared, e.g., integers, floating-point numbers, strings, etc) of an array (or a list) in a certain order (increasing, non-decreasing (increasing or flat), decreasing, non-increasing (decreasing or flat), lexicographical, etc).There are many different sorting algorithms, each has its own …

WebFeb 20, 2024 · Sorting in C++ is a concept in which the elements of an array are rearranged in a logical order. This order can be from lowest to highest or highest to lowest. Sorting … WebFeb 3, 2024 · Binary Sort Algorithm Complexity Binary sort is a comparison type sorting algorithm. It is a modification of the insertion sort algorithm. In this algorithm, we also …

WebBinary function that accepts two elements in the range as arguments, and returns a value convertible to bool. The value returned indicates whether the element passed as first …

WebThe bubble sort algorithm compares two adjacent elements and swaps them if they are not in the intended order. In this tutorial, we will learn about the working of the bubble sort algorithm along with its implementations … simple chicken pot pie with biscuitsWebSteps to perform the binary search in C++. Step 1: Declare the variables and input all elements of an array in sorted order (ascending or descending). Step 2: Divide the lists of array elements into halves. Step 3: Now compare the target elements with the middle element of the array. And if the value of the target element is matched with the middle … simple chicken satay recipeWebNov 22, 2024 · C++ Server Side Programming Programming. Binary Insertion sort is a special type up of Insertion sort which uses binary search algorithm to find out the … simple chicken pot pie recipe with biscuits